Tabonga | 2,324 Posted July 5, 2023 Share Posted July 5, 2023 (edited) I was rewatching "Son of the Morning Star" (which if you haven't seen it is probably the best film recreation of the Battle of the The Little Bighorn) and I noticed something I hadn't before. At 7:30 in on this clip there is a scene of two Native Americans dragging a white captive in the background. Blink and you will miss it, In the battle when Reno's command charged the village 3 or so of his soldiers' mounts bolted and carried them into the village - where they would have been easily captured. That night Reno's soldiers (trapped on their hill) could hear the sounds of captives being tortured. When the Native Americans left and they entered the remains of the village they found 3 heads with no bodies. As a side note the Native American woman speaking is voiced by Buffy Sainte-Marie - a famous (in the day) folk singer.
